What's a funny mnemonic you've made for yourself?

Sometimes WaniKani mnemonics just don’t hit for you and you make up your own (at least this happens for me) do you have any you like a lot?

Personally for me とり = 鳥(bird) has the mnemocic in a bad Brittish accent “Oi! That bird’s a tory!”

and もり=森(Forest) has the mnemonic “The Wrestler Takeshi Morishima isn’t active anymore, he went into the forest to retire”

As for funny mnemonics. I don’t go to deep into that stuff. But this is one I like:

I always kept switching these two. Is it kono, or noko?
好む (to like): このむ
残す (to leave behind): のこす

From early on, my favourite Japanese word has to be 九つ (nine things) ここのつ. 好む shares the same kono order, so that must be the one I like!

In Batman Forever (uhh, spoilers I guess) when the bad guys attack the circus (where the clowns live), their leader is Two-Face. When he escapes he waves bye.

This is how I remember 倍 (double) / ばい .
